Neverwinter: Avernus releases on Xbox One and PS4

Neverwinter provides a world that keeps on growing, expanding, evolving. And the latest major update to hit the game on Xbox One and PS4 is that of Avernus – and it’s available right now.

Coming from Perfect World Entertainment and Cryptic Studios, Neverwinter: Avernus is the next instalment to the free-to-play action MMORPG; one that is based on the acclaimed Dungeons & Dragons franchise. Continuing and concluding the events of the previous major update Infernal Descent, the Avernus update sends players deeper into the infernal depths of the wastelands of Avernus, the first layer of the Nine Hells.

Following on from the events of Infernal Descent, the previous major update for Neverwinter, it’s now time to head across the wastelands of Avernus, the first layer of the Nine Hells. In it you’ll stumble upon the remains of the Vallenhas stronghold, meeting Lulu, a curious hollyphant and Archdevil Zariel’s old companion. With a locked infernal puzzle box in your possession, Lulu offers aid in opening it; the only problem is, she has lost her memories and the only hope of restoring them is by embarking on an odyssey through Avernus. And it is here where you’ll be likely to team up with two companions: Makos and the opportunistic merchant, Mahadi.

As you explore the sprawling Adventure Zone of Avernus, you’ll find yourself fighting through hordes of demons and devils, all before challenging the powerful ruler of Avernus, Archdevil Zariel. This promises to deliver one hell of an epic journey, as you also take part in the brand new Path of the Fallen campaign. Do so and you will earn new rewards, drive infernal war machines and experience how your actions directly impact and evolve the world of Avernus.

You can grab Neverwinter right now on Xbox One, PC and PS4, with it free-to-play across all formats. Let us know in the comments if you’ll be dropping in now that Avernus is on console.
